Ordinals
beta
Sat 950784377595518
decimal
190156.4377595518
degree
0°190156′652″4377595518‴
percentile
45.275446601970536%
name
hcqdzjluvpr
cycle
0
epoch
0
period
94
block
190156
offset
4377595518
timestamp
2012-07-22 01:38:50 UTC
rarity
common
prev
next